The Senior Director of HIV/STI Resources & Prevention is responsible for the strategic oversight and management of all HIV/STI testing and prevention and the HUB/Hotline programs and services. This role involves developing and implementing evidence-based strategies to reduce HIV/STI transmission within the community, overseeing testing services, and ensuring the delivery of comprehensive prevention education. This role also involves strategic leadership to the HUB/Hotline team. The Senior Director manages a team of healthcare professionals, secures funding through grants and partnerships, and ensures compliance with all relevant health regulations and standards.
Additionally, they collaborate with community organizations to enhance service outreach, advocate for public health policies, and ensure that all programs are inclusive, culturally competent, and responsive to the needs of diverse populations.
